Rembrandt Oltmans 14.1 7 **RQ001: Robot has the ability to play sounds**
Rembrandt Oltmans 15.1 8 Function description: It is critical for the functionality of the system that the robot is able to play specific songs at certain times. In order to achieve this the robot should be able to play sounds at an audible volume in the room and the Choregraphe Studio program should allow for picking and streaming songs to the NAO. This can be seen as one of the most important requirements as without it the system can not execute it's core functions.

Rembrandt Oltmans 14.1 10 **RQ002: Robot should recognize an indication of being done**
Rembrandt Oltmans 15.1 11 Function description: In order to know when the patient has completed a task, or the patient wants to stop the music as he knows the task to perform, the robot should be able to recognize an indication of being done. This indication can be given in various ways, one of those is through speech which depends on RQ009. However, other indications can be used to denote being finished such as detecting a hand signal from the patient or visually recognizing the completion of the current activity.
